Forced dlss 4.5 preset M. Ray reconstruction. Running 120 fps in virtual desktop but with asw on all the time. God like res in virtual desktop. High textures. Dlss performance as m preset looks good. 30 ppd, aer 1/2 and aer V2.

That's off the top of my head. There are so many other settings in this game. I'm sure it can do with some tinkering but it looks good and it stays at 60 fps in the in game overlay (= 120 fps with ASW in virtual desktop overlay). I don't usually use forced asw nor 120 fps but it works well with this mod. Usually normal pcvr or uevr I target 72 fps and no ASW.
